    The Directorate of Vigilance and Anti-Corruption (DVAC) on Tuesday conducted searches at 41 locations across Tamil Nadu as part of its investigation into alleged irregularities and misappropriation in the Tamil Nadu State Marketing Corporation (TASMAC).

    The raids included the residence of former Tamil Nadu Minister and DMK MLA V Senthil Balaji in Karur, along with the premises of several of his associates. DVAC officials also questioned Senthil Balaji at a private hotel in Chennai, where he is currently staying.

    Complaint registered over alleged TASMAC irregularities

    The searches follow the registration of a complaint by the DVAC against Senthilbalaji, a former Managing Director of TASMAC, and several officials of the state-run liquor retailer over alleged financial irregularities and malpractice.

    Senthilbalaji had served as Tamil Nadu’s Minister for Prohibition and Excise in the previous DMK government, a portfolio under which TASMAC functions.

    Raids span multiple districts

    As part of the investigation, DVAC teams also searched the premises of Golden Vats Pvt. Ltd., a liquor manufacturing company in Tiruvarur that investigators allege is linked to DMK MP T.R. Baalu.

    Search operations were carried out across Chennai, Pudukkottai, Tiruvarur, Karur, Thanjavur, Coimbatore, Namakkal, Tiruppur, Erode, The Nilgiris, Tiruvallur, Kancheepuram, Villupuram and Sivaganga.

    Officials are examining documents and financial records as part of the ongoing probe.

    Political row over TASMAC allegations

    The alleged irregularities have triggered a political confrontation in Tamil Nadu.

    The ruling TVK has repeatedly accused Senthil Balaji of corruption in TASMAC operations. Chief Minister C. Joseph Vijay had earlier alleged that the purported irregularities amounted to a “party fund.”

    The DMK has rejected the allegations and denied any wrongdoing.

    The DVAC investigation is continuing, and officials are expected to scrutinise financial transactions and other evidence collected during the searches.
